id	summary	reporter	owner	description	type	status	priority	milestone	component	version	resolution	keywords	cc	blockedby	blocking	branch_state	votes
1511	User-defined user interface themes	sergey-feo		"(Excuse me for my bad English :-) )

QT- and GTK-based programs can have ""skins"". Window managers can have themes. 

I suggest make such feature in mc and make some default themes:
— theme without pseudographics for users that have problems with locale and use mc to solve it;
— default Borland Turbo Vision-like theme that uses only pseudographics from CP437 encoding. This pseudographics symbols can be used with many 8-bit encodings;
— enchanced theme wich uses all power of Unicode pseudographics.
In this theme we can do following replacements:
[x] → ☑ /  ✓⃞ ;
[ ] → ☐ /   ⃞ ; 
(*) → ◉ /  •⃝ ;
( ) → ○ /   ⃝ ;
With Unicode we also can add ""✓"" to ""OK"" buttons and ""✗"" to ""Cancel"" buttons. It will be like pictograms. Also ""⚠""/"" !⃤ "" and "" ?⃝ "" can be used as pictograms for some dialogs, ""⌨"" in keyboard settings. If mc somedays will use DeviceKit-disks then ""⏏"" symbol can be used for ejecting media.

------------
Regards, Sergey
"	enhancement	new	minor	Future Releases	mc-skin	4.7.0-pre3			gotar@… ales.janda@…			no branch	
